Florida ‘Robbed’ by Controversial Call as Gators Become Latest Victim of SEC Referees

The Florida Gators were “robbed” against the Georgia Bulldogs today, according to fans who blame SEC referees for the loss.

The Florida Gators fell despite a massive effort in a tough encounter against the Georgia Bulldogs following a controversial call. The Gators were ahead early in the fourth quarter against a 6-1 Georgia side coming off a win against a ranked SEC rival, Ole Miss.

The Bulldogs now have two ranked wins and are 7-1 on the season following their victory over Florida. According to PFSN’s College Football Playoff Meter, they had a 71.9% chance of reaching the playoffs before today’s game. This makes interim head coach Billy Gonzales’s efforts extremely successful despite the loss.

Florida ‘Robbed’ by Controversial Call, According to Fans Following Georgia Loss

During the matchup against the Bulldogs, the Gators had a chance to take the lead in the fourth quarter. However, a call went against them, and fans of the program began to question the referees following the decision. This was one of many questionable SEC refereeing decisions today.

“Florida got screwed man If It takes 2+ minutes to decide something Isn’t a catch It’s a catch unreal,” one fan argued. This catch came in the dying minutes of the fourth quarter on 3rd & 4 with the Gators down by four.

“Florida was just robbed. That was 100% a catch. The college replay system is awful,” another fan added.

“If it takes 2+ minutes to decide something *is* a catch, it isn’t a catch. Fixed it for you,” another fan argued.

During the matchup against the Gators, the Bulldogs’ sophomore defensive back KJ Bolden was ejected from the game following a targeting call. However, many believed that it was completely farcical and nowhere near worth the ejection.

“This wasn’t called targeting on Caleb Downs, but KJ Bolden hits a player in the chest and gets ejected? The SEC refs are the worst of the worst,” one fan questioned following the decision.

Been saying for a while that the SEC uses replay to rig games. You can’t deny it after that atrocity unless you are a homer. In a few years when they are investigated by a non biased entity everyone will say ‘what took so long to see the obvious?'” another fan commented.

Today’s game may have given Florida a glint of hope in an otherwise difficult season. Coming off a victory against Mississippi State, the Gators are currently 3-4 on the season. They are also 2-2 within the SEC, with the interim head coach almost winning against a ranked opponent in his first game.
